A light designed to bring calm and warmth.
ASTER is a modular lighting system developed in collaboration with AGO Lighting, inspired by the night sky and the idea of light as a spatial element. Defined by a clear and balanced geometry, ASTER begins as a single, self-contained light; calm, precise, and quietly present. Through its modular structure, it can expand into larger compositions, where multiple units connect to form more expressive, architectural arrangements. Designed to adapt over time, the system moves fluidly between scales and contexts, from intimate interiors to larger public environments. This flexibility allows ASTER to shift between being a subtle object and a more defining spatial presence. The project reflects a shared ambition between AGO and Note to create a lighting system that is both complete in its singular form and open to growth. The name ASTER, derived from “star,” points to this idea: individual elements that hold their own identity while forming greater constellations through connection.
